You will be responsible for defining and evolving the developer web strategy, ensuring Arm’s developer sites provide intuitive, discoverable, high-quality experiences that help developers find the technical content, tools, software, and resources they need. You will work closely with Developer Marketing, Business Units, Engineering, Web teams, IT, and business stakeholders to translate developer and business requirements into an effective web strategy and roadmap.

You will also own and manage the feature roadmap for the Arm Developer Dashboard, working with stakeholders and delivery teams to identify, prioritize, and deliver capabilities that improve the authenticated developer experience.

AI will be fundamental to the role. You will drive an AI-first approach to developer web experiences, identifying opportunities to use AI to improve discovery, navigation, personalization, developer journeys, content experiences, and interactions across Arm’s developer web estate. You will also ensure Arm’s developer web experiences and content are structured to be discoverable and useful through emerging AI-driven search and discovery experiences.

This role is ideal for someone who combines strategic web thinking with strong execution, understands developer audiences and digital journeys, and can bring together requirements from multiple teams into a coherent product and web roadmap.

Hybrid Working at Arm

Arm’s approach to hybrid working is designed to create a working environment that supports both high performance and personal wellbeing. We believe in bringing people together face to face to enable us to work at pace, whilst recognizing the value of flexibility. Within that framework, we empower groups/teams to determine their own hybrid working patterns, depending on the work and the team’s needs. Details of what this means for each role will be shared upon application. In some cases, the flexibility we can offer is limited by local legal, regulatory, tax, or other considerations, and where this is the case, we will collaborate with you to find the best solution. Please talk to us to find out more about what this could look like for you.
